Safety ratings on the Monroney label include crash test results from agencies like the NHTSA and IIHS, providing an assessment of the vehicle's safety.
A VIN decoder reveals the vehicle's trim level by decoding specific characters of the VIN that relate to the vehicle's series and equipment levels.
Car depreciation is the decrease in value of a vehicle over time. It's a crucial factor to consider when calculating the total cost of vehicle ownership.

The manufacturing location can be interpreted from the first character of the VIN, which indicates the country of assembly, and sometimes more specific location details are included in the first few characters.
Depreciation directly affects the resale value of a 2004 PONTIAC GRAND AM, with faster depreciating vehicles typically having lower resale values over time.
You can track the depreciation of your car by monitoring market trends, checking online valuation tools, and staying informed about new model releases.
